What are Pytest, Python, and Selenium?

Pytest is a popular testing framework for Python that makes it easy to write simple and scalable test cases. Python is a versatile, high-level programming language widely used for automation, web development, data analysis, and testing. Selenium is an open-source tool used for automating web browsers, enabling developers to write scripts in Python (or other languages) to simulate user interactions and verify web application behavior. Together, Pytest, Python, and Selenium are commonly used for automated testing of web applications to ensure they function as expected.

What are some common challenges faced by Pytest Python Selenium automation engineers when maintaining test suites over time?

Automation engineers using Pytest, Python, and Selenium often encounter challenges like test flakiness due to dynamic web elements, frequent UI changes that require updates to selectors, and managing dependencies between tests. As projects grow, maintaining clear test structure and ensuring tests remain reliable and independent is crucial. Engineers frequently collaborate with developers and QA teams to prioritize test coverage and quickly address issues that arise from application changes.

Job description

The Automation Test Engineer will be responsible for ensuring the quality, integrity, and reliability of enterprise data warehouse applications, ETL pipelines, and backend systems. The role involves validating data transformations, developing automated testing solutions, performing database testing, and ensuring accurate reporting across cloud-based data platforms. Working within an Agile Scrum team, the engineer will collaborate with developers, data engineers, and business analysts to deliver high-quality, scalable data solutions.

This role is ideal for a QA professional with strong expertise in database testing, ETL validation, backend automation, and cloud- based data platforms, who is passionate about delivering high- quality, reliable enterprise data solutions.

The Work:

  • Perform ETL, backend database, and data warehouse testing.
  • Develop and execute manual and automated test cases for data pipelines and backend applications.
  • Validate source-to-target data transformations, business rules, and data quality using SQL.
  • Design ,developand maintain automation frameworks for ETL, database, and regression testing using Python and SQL.
  • Execute data validation, reconciliation, row count, aggregate, and data integrity testing.
  • Validate cloud-based data platforms including AWS, Databricks, Redshift, Amazon S3, and RDS.
  • Develop test plans based on business requirements and acceptance criteria.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ional Agile teams to support sprint planning, defect resolution, and release validation.
  • Participate in system integration, regression, and performance testing.
  • Identifydefects, perform root cause analysis, and recommend process improvements.
